Name: Bacteroides gracilis Tanner et al. 1981
Etymology: gra’ci.lis. L. masc./fem. adj. gracilis, slim, slender, thin
Type strain: ATCC 33236; CCUG 27720; DSM 19528; FDC 1084; JCM 8538; NCTC 12738

Valid publication:
Tanner ACR, Badger S, Lai CH, Listgarten MA, Visconti RA, Socransky SS. Wolinella gen. nov., Wolinella succinogenes (Vibrio succinogenes Wolin et al.) comb. nov., and description of Bacteroides gracilis sp. nov., Wolinella recta sp. nov., Campylobacter concisus sp. nov., and Eikenella corrodens from humans with periodontal disease. Int. J. Syst. Bacteriol. 1981; 31:432-445.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P
Correct name: Campylobacter gracilis (Tanner et al. 1981) Vandamme et al. 1995
